Merit Financial Group LLC Purchases 163,441 Shares of NVIDIA Co. (NASDAQ:NVDA)

NVIDIA logo with Computer and Technology background

Merit Financial Group LLC boosted its position in shares of NVIDIA Co. (NASDAQ:NVDA - Free Report) by 33.6% during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 649,837 shares of the computer hardware maker's stock after acquiring an additional 163,441 shares during the period. NVIDIA accounts for about 1.1% of Merit Financial Group LLC's investment portfolio, making the stock its 20th largest position. Merit Financial Group LLC's holdings in NVIDIA were worth $70,429,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

NVIDIA (NASDAQ:NVDA -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 28th. The computer hardware maker reported $0.81 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.87 by ($0.06). The firm had revenue of $44.06 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$43.09 billion. NVIDIA had a return on equity of 114.83% and a net margin of 55.69%.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 69.2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.61 earnings per share. On average, analysts predict that NVIDIA Co. will post 2.77 earnings per share for the current year.

NVIDIA Company Profile

NVIDIA Corporation provides graphics and compute and networking solutions in the United States, Taiwan, China, Hong Kong, and internationally. The Graphics segment offers GeForce GPUs for gaming and PCs, the GeForce NOW game streaming service and related infrastructure, and solutions for gaming platforms; Quadro/NVIDIA RTX GPUs for enterprise workstation graphics; virtual GPU or vGPU software for cloud-based visual and virtual computing; automotive platforms for infotainment systems; and Omniverse software for building and operating metaverse and 3D internet applications.
